微机原理与接口技术:8259A中断控制器详解

需积分: 15 1 下载量 89 浏览量 更新于2024-08-22 收藏 8.48MB PPT 举报
"微机原理与接口技术复习课件涵盖了8259A中断结束方式、微机系统的基础知识以及相关课程的详细教学计划。课程包括数制与码制、8086CPU、指令系统、汇编语言、总线、存储器设计、常用芯片接口技术、中断系统、定时/计数器8253和并行接口芯片8255A的应用设计等内容。8259A中断结束方式分为自动中断结束方式(AEOI)和非自动中断结束方式(EOI),中断服务完成后需发送命令清除中断级在ISR中的对应位。" 在微机原理与接口技术这门课程中,8259A可编程中断控制器扮演了重要角色。它主要用于管理微处理器接收到的各种外部中断请求,确保中断处理的有序进行。中断结束方式是中断处理流程的关键部分,8259A提供了两种中断结束机制: 1. 自动中断结束方式(Automatic End-of-Interrupt,AEOI):当微处理器执行完中断服务程序后,8259A会自动清除中断请求标志,表示中断已经结束,无需CPU额外发送EOI命令。 2. 非自动中断结束方式(End-of-Interrupt,EOI):在这种方式下,CPU在完成中断服务后,需要向8259A发送一个EOI命令,以清除ISR(中断服务寄存器)中的相应位,表明中断处理完成。 中断系统是微机硬件与软件之间的重要通信机制,允许系统对突发事件做出快速响应。8259A中断控制器可以管理和优先级排序多个中断源,使得高优先级的中断可以打断低优先级中断的处理,从而优化系统的响应速度和效率。 课程的其他部分包括了基础的数制与码制概念,如二进制数的运算规则、有符号数的表示以及ASCII编码等。此外,8086CPU的结构与功能、指令系统、汇编语言程序设计也是学习的重点。课程还涉及了总线、存储器设计,以及常用的接口芯片如8253定时/计数器和8255A并行接口的使用,这些都是构建和理解微机系统不可或缺的知识。 通过这样的课程设置,学生能够全面了解微机系统的工作原理,并掌握如何利用这些技术进行实际的系统设计和开发。实验课时的设置则让学生有机会亲手实践,巩固理论知识,提高实际操作能力。